Responsibilities
- Lead end-to-end recruitment process including sourcing, interviewing, and onboarding top talent
- Develop and implement HR policies ensuring compliance with Indonesian labor regulations
- Manage employee relations programs, conflict resolution, and performance management systems
- Design and administer competitive compensation and benefits packages
- Drive employee engagement initiatives and foster positive workplace culture
- Oversee training and development programs to enhance employee capabilities
- Manage HRIS systems and maintain accurate employee records
- Analyze HR metrics and provide strategic recommendations to leadership
Qualifications
- Bachelor's degree in Human Resources, Business Administration, or related field
- Minimum 3-5 years of progressive HR experience with 2+ years in managerial role
- Deep understanding of Indonesian labor laws (KUHP, PP No. 78/2015)
- Proven experience in recruitment strategies and talent acquisition
- Strong knowledge of compensation & benefits frameworks
- Excellent interpersonal and conflict resolution skills
- Proficiency in HRIS systems and MS Office Suite
- Strategic thinking with ability to translate business goals into HR initiatives
